N.J. Stat. § 56:3A-10: Application of act

10. a. This act shall not apply to contracts between performing rights societies and broadcasters licensed by the Federal Communications Commission, except that if a performing rights society is licensed by the Federal Communications Commission, this act shall apply to contracts between that performing rights society and a proprietor as otherwise provided herein.

b. This act shall not apply to any conduct by law enforcement officers or other persons engaged in the enforcement of section 1 of P.L.1991, c.125 (C.2C:21-21).

L.1996,c.122,s.10.
